Elemental distribution in tissue components of N(2)-fixing nodules of Psoralea pinnata plants growing naturally in wetland and upland conditions in the Cape Fynbos of South Africa
There is little information on in situ distribution of nutrient elements in N(2)-fixing nodules. The aim of this study was to quantify elemental distribution in tissue components of N(2)-fixing nodules harvested from Psoralea pinnata plants grown naturally in wetland and upland conditions in the Cap...
